Bitten by ant
I was bitten by an ant yesterday night in my left foot, it is swollen up since last night. What to do?

Hello, Treat mild sting reactions by washing the affected area with soap and water and covering with a bandage. Applying ice can reduce the pain. Topical treatments include over-the-counter steroid creams to reduce pain and itch. Bites should go away in about a week. Scratching can cause the bites to become infected, in which case they may last longer. So don't scatch it . Swelling will subside by time don't worry.
